Why is Kamakhya so famous?

Situated on the Nilachal hills, this temple is an important pilgrimage centre for tantric worshippers and Hindus. It is also considered important as it is the temple where the beliefs and practices of the Aryan communities coincide with non-Aryan communities.

Why is Assam famous for tourism?

This north-eastern state along the Brahmaputra and Barak rivers is famous for its wildlife, tea plantations, temples, ancient archaeological sites of the Ahom dynasty (which ruled Assam for 600 years from 13-19th centuries), and the rich tribal culture and handicrafts.
